Changeset: 404941ab08b7 for MonetDB URL: https://dev.monetdb.org/hg/MonetDB?cmd=changeset;node=404941ab08b7 Modified Files: testing/CMakeLists.txt Branch: cmake-fun Log Message:
Install Mapprove only on install phase. diffs (16 lines): diff --git a/testing/CMakeLists.txt b/testing/CMakeLists.txt --- a/testing/CMakeLists.txt +++ b/testing/CMakeLists.txt @@ -81,10 +81,6 @@ if(WIN32) else() configure_file(Mlog.in ${CMAKE_CURRENT_BINARY_DIR}/Mlog @ONLY) install(FILES ${CMAKE_CURRENT_BINARY_DIR}/Mlog PERMISSIONS ${PROGRAM_PERMISSIONS_DEFAULT} DESTINATION ${BINDIR}) - - add_custom_target(Mapprove ALL - COMMAND ${CMAKE_COMMAND} -E make_directory ${BINDIR} - COMMAND ${CMAKE_COMMAND} -E create_symlink Mtest.py ${BINDIR}/Mapprove.py - COMMENT "Creating symlink to Mtest.py") - add_dependencies(Mdiff Mapprove) # Hack, this will make the custom_target "Mapprove" run every time + install(CODE "execute_process(COMMAND ${CMAKE_COMMAND} -E make_directory ${BINDIR})") + install(CODE "execute_process(COMMAND ${CMAKE_COMMAND} -E create_symlink Mtest.py ${BINDIR}/Mapprove.py)") endif() _______________________________________________ checkin-list mailing list checkin-list@monetdb.org https://www.monetdb.org/mailman/listinfo/checkin-list